Post real knock and noise knock

how can I tell if i'm getting fake knock or real knock? Would the knock degrees slowly go up for real knock like say 1.5,2, 3.5?

Lower the boost and or raise the octane until the knock drops. If no change then it may be false. Maybe exhaust hitting or broken motor mount are common causes.
